Reddit Implements Age Verification in the UK: A Step Towards Safer Online Spaces

In response to new regulations, Reddit has introduced age verification measures for users in the UK. This move aims to ensure compliance with evolving online safety standards and protect users, especially minors, from accessing potentially harmful content. Under these new rules, UK Reddit users must upload their ID or a selfie to verify their age before accessing certain areas of the platform.
